How they compare
Malta currently reports 0.219 units per square kilometre against 0.1508 units per square kilometre in Lebanon, a difference of 0.0682 units per square kilometre.
That makes Malta's figure about 1.5 times Lebanon's.
Across all 34 years both countries report, Malta has been ahead every year.
Lebanon ranks 12th and Malta ranks 9th of 186 countries.
Malta has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
